I have a question regarding RT update verses Bulk Update. If we don’t 
wish a message to be sent to a Cc or Bcc member of any given ticket we 
have to check a box in front of their name(s) and then click on “Save 
changes” button, then click on the “Update Ticket” to accomplish this 
which is not a big deal, unless we went wrong during the installation. 
However, the “Save changes” button is not available in Bulk Update. Is 
this by design? If not, can it be added? Is there any other way script 
or otherwise to achieve this? We are using RT 3.6.4
